A Delicate Case of Murder

A Delicate Case of Murder begins with a séance. The person conducting the séance is a lady called Laura Winstead and her husband Harvey is very sceptical of her gifts.  Frederica Keaton on the other hand remains open-minded about the whole thing and is flabbergasted when her dead mother materialises in the room, right in front of her eyes.

It is an impressive show but Harvey later shows Frederica the secret behind his wife’s power and Frederica is shocked to discover that Laura Winstead is not all that she seems. Laura is not the only one who has been keeping secrets though. Harvey and Frederica have been seeing each other behind Laura’s back and when he asks his wife for a divorce she refuses him. She also assures Frederica that although the materialization was a fraud the voice of her mother was not. When Harvey remains unconvinced Laura tells him that she has a feeling that some day soon she will manage to convince him of her powers and that when she does he will never be able to scoff at her again. Her feeling turns out to be right and nobody lives happily ever after.
